The live script uses a mount command that specifies the type of the filesystem
to mount. For some reason this fails dropping me into the initramfs prompt. I
get the following in the live.log file:
debug: Can not mount backev /dev/loop0 (image
= /live/image/live/filesystem.squashfs) on
croot/imagename //filesystem.squashfs
mount: failed ...
I've attached a patch that removes the type which allows the mount to
complete.
